Types of ground in Agramunt
In Agramunt, soils of sandstones, conglomerates and flysch predominate, which gives the subsoil a high bearing capacity and adequate stability for shallow or semi-deep foundations. However, the occasional presence of gypsum, anhydrite and salts introduces a risk of dissolution that must be analysed, as it may affect the integrity of the foundations if they are found at depth or in proximity to the level of structural support. The low permeability of the formations limits the mobility of water, but it may lead to local shallow aquifers.
Seismic activity in the area is very low, with only 6 recorded events over 30 years and a low maximum magnitude (Mmax 2), so the seismic condition is negligible in structural design. Nevertheless, the possible presence of karst processes associated with gypsum and salts makes it essential to verify the karst before constructing the foundations, as it could generate unanticipated subsidence or cavities, constituting the main geotechnical risk in the municipality. In addition, the non-clayey substratum rules out the possibility of expansivity, facilitating the selection of conventional foundation solutions if no karst-related effects are identified.
